Course Highlights
Bear Slide consistently delivers fast, true-rolling greens and well-maintained fairways that reward strategic play on a long but fair layout. The links-style design offers a genuine challenge with beautiful bunkers and a course layout that tests golfers of all skill levels.

One of Indy metro's better options

I also posted earlier in the season on this course......

It is a good bit north of town, but worth the commute to get there. There are just a couple of holes that feel stuck in there in the design, but the other 15-16 are fantastic in design.

For some reason the aeration from the spring is still in the healing process and ever so slightly bumpy, but it is almost up to tip top shape......This course generally plays firm and fast which I enjoy and it is coming into form.

Great pace of play and peaceful location all about the golf.....You don't have to play in someone's backyard here. This is a "shotmakers" course and you have to put your ball in position and control spin to score here.

Excellent practice and warm up facilities here.....

Great Indy Golf

Bear Slide may not get the public kudos more well-known top tracks in the Indy area receive - Purgatory, Prairie View and the Trophy Club to name a few, but it belongs right up there. It's a good challenge, especially with the wind up, well-maintained and has a lot of variety in its makeup, especially the back 9. As with several other area courses right now, the greens are a little firm and not holding much, but they roll well.

Anyone would do well to make the drive and play this excellent course.

Bear Slide Worth the Trip

A destination golf course near the Indianapolis area. Open links style golf on the front with some fun challenging holes that require some strategy. Pick you tee box wisely as the course is a par 71. Back side gets a bit more challenging. The course, on this side, becomes more of a target golf course and favors the accurate iron player. Hole 11 seems to need a rework but is a fun hole if you can hit the green in regulation.

For April, the course was in very good condition.

Very nice course - will try to play again

Ended up with an extra day on a trip to Indy so looked around for a nice course to play. Considered a few others but this was relatively close and looked good. The weather turned a bit overnight and at the start it was pretty cool and more than a little breezy. Sun came out and layers came off on the 2nd nine. Paired up with a couple locals which really helped as there were some holes that even with my GPS and the nice guidebook on the cart it would have been tough to get good aim points. Fairways were all very good. Greens were quite fast and pretty smooth/true although a little thin - I would give that a nice. That would be really my only minor knock on the experience. Great layout, great visuals, great variety of holes, lots of elevation changes. Longer hitters should possibly play the blues but the whites were a pretty good challenge. Anyone that plays from the blacks here is a pro or crazy long. Pace of play we great. The GolfNow deal was with a cart and it would be a tough walk with some distance between green/next tee and just the elevation. All in all it was a great day of golf on a very, very, nice course. I recommend it highly and will certainly try to play it again - ideally with the same guys that I paired up with this time.
